Today my Haley turns twelve.  
The party was a lot of fun.  


The girls went on a Bigger or Better scavenger hunt.  (When  my brother did this once he came back with a pair of skis.) 
I sent each team out with a bar of soap and  they went to five homes and traded the items that they got at the previous home for something bigger or better.
I about fell over laughing when one team came home with an AB Lounge and a Chocolate Fondue set.   (Just for the record: that blows skis out of the water!)
I can't believe that 4 girls hauled that huge thing about five blocks!
